小编Nea*_*alR的帖子

用于填充div内部文本的CSS属性

有没有办法给div元素一些填充内边框?例如,当前主div元素内的所有文本都直接到元素边框的边缘.作为这个网站的一般规则,我想在文本和边框之间留出至少10到20像素的空间.

这是一个屏幕截图,用于说明我目前拥有的内容:

在此输入图像描述

html css

25
推荐指数
3
解决办法
11万
查看次数

@ Html.DisplayText实际上不会显示文本

以下是我的一个ASP MVC3索引页面上表格第一行的第一部分.当页面加载时我已经完成了代码,并且可以看到条件的评估已正确完成,但不是"CE"或"PT"显示.我是ASP MVC的新手,有人可以帮我解释语法/解释发生了什么吗?

@foreach (var item in Model.Where(i => i.Status != "C")) {
var Id = item.Id;
<tr>
    <td>
    @if (!String.IsNullOrWhiteSpace(item.TableName))
    {
        if (item.TableName.Equals("AgentContEd"))
        {
            @Html.DisplayText("CE");
        }
        else if (item.TableName.Equals("AgentProductTraining"))
        {
            @Html.DisplayText("PT");
        }
        else
        {
            @Html.DisplayFor(modelItem => item.TableName)
        }             
    }           
    </td>
Run Code Online (Sandbox Code Playgroud)

c# asp.net-mvc razor

24
推荐指数
3
解决办法
5万
查看次数

未捕获更多上下文对象,而不是路径的动态段:post

我正在尝试按照这个基本的Ember.js教程,但没有运气的"帖子"模型.我根据演示设置了所有内容,但是我收到错误:

Uncaught More context objects were passed than there are dynamic segments for the route: post

由于这是我第一次使用Ember.js应用程序,所以老实说我不知道​​这意味着什么.任何帮助(字面上的任何东西)将不胜感激.

这是我的App.js

App = Ember.Application.create();

App.Store = DS.Store.extend({
    adapter: 'DS.FixtureAdapter'
});

App.Router.map(function () {
    this.resource('posts', function() {
        this.resource('post', { path:'post_id'})
    });
    this.resource('about');
});

App.PostsRoute = Ember.Route.extend({
    model: function () {
        return App.Post.find();
    }
})

App.Post = DS.Model.extend({
    title: DS.attr('string'),
    author: DS.attr('string'),
    intro: DS.attr('string'),
    extended: DS.attr('string'),
    publishedAt: DS.attr('date')
});

App.Post.FIXTURES = [{
        id: 1,
        title: "Rails in Omakase",
        author: "d2h",
        publishedAt: new Date('12-27-2012'), …
Run Code Online (Sandbox Code Playgroud)

javascript handlebars.js ember.js

22
推荐指数
1
解决办法
2万
查看次数

使用EPPlus使列或单元格只读

有没有办法使用EPPlus锁定或读取一列或一组单元格?我已尝试将下面的代码分开并一起使用,但似乎都没有达到预期的效果.整个工作表是锁定的(如果我包含该IsProtected语句)或根本没有.

        ws.Protection.IsProtected = true;
        ws.Column(10).Style.Locked = true;
Run Code Online (Sandbox Code Playgroud)

编辑

这是我的控制器的整个代码块

        FileInfo newFile = new FileInfo("C:\\Users\\" + User.Identity.Name + "\\Desktop" + @"\\ZipCodes.xlsx");

        ExcelPackage pck = new ExcelPackage(newFile);

        var ws = pck.Workbook.Worksheets.Add("Query_" + DateTime.Now.ToString());

        //Headers
        ws.Cells["A1"].Value = "ChannelCode";
        ws.Cells["B1"].Value = "DrmTerrDesc";
        ws.Cells["C1"].Value = "IndDistrnId";
        ws.Cells["D1"].Value = "StateCode";
        ws.Cells["E1"].Value = "ZipCode";
        ws.Cells["F1"].Value = "EndDate";
        ws.Cells["G1"].Value = "EffectiveDate";
        ws.Cells["H1"].Value = "LastUpdateId";
        ws.Cells["J1"].Value = "ErrorCodes";
        ws.Cells["K1"].Value = "Status";
        ws.Cells["I1"].Value = "Id";

        //Content
        int i = 2;
        foreach (var zip in results)
        {
            ws.Cells["A" + …
Run Code Online (Sandbox Code Playgroud)

.net c# excel asp.net-mvc-3 epplus

18
推荐指数
3
解决办法
2万
查看次数

EPPlus自动过滤器仅适用于最后一个单元

我希望标题中的每个单元格都包含一个自动过滤器.下面是我试图使用的代码,但是autofilter只在指定的最后一个单元格上设置了.

例如,如果我注释掉该autofilter命令K1,则将创建电子表格,该电子表格是C1唯一具有自动过滤器的单元格.

        //Headers
        ws.Cells["A1"].Value = "ChannelCode";
        ws.Cells["A1"].AutoFilter = true;
        ws.Cells["B1"].Value = "DrmTerrDesc";
        ws.Cells["B1"].AutoFilter = true;
        ws.Cells["C1"].Value = "IndDistrnId";
        ws.Cells["C1"].AutoFilter = true;
        ws.Cells["D1"].Value = "StateCode";
        ws.Cells["D1"].AutoFilter = true;
        ws.Cells["E1"].Value = "ZipCode";
        ws.Cells["E1"].AutoFilter = true;
        ws.Cells["F1"].Value = "EndDate";
        ws.Cells["F1"].AutoFilter = true;
        ws.Cells["G1"].Value = "EffectiveDate";
        ws.Cells["G1"].AutoFilter = true;
        ws.Cells["H1"].Value = "LastUpdateId";
        ws.Cells["H1"].AutoFilter = true;
        ws.Cells["I1"].Value = "ErrorCodes";
        ws.Cells["I1"].AutoFilter = true;
        ws.Cells["J1"].Value = "Status";
        ws.Cells["J1"].AutoFilter = true;
        ws.Cells["K1"].Value = "Id";
        ws.Cells["K1"].AutoFilter = true;
Run Code Online (Sandbox Code Playgroud)

.net c# excel epplus

18
推荐指数
3
解决办法
1万
查看次数

连接到SSIS中Script Task中的SQL数据库

在SSIS中的脚本任务内部,我需要调用SQL数据库.我有一个连接字符串是在我将数据库添加到数据源文件夹时创建的,但是现在我不确定如何在C#代码中引用它.我知道如何在ASP网站的代码中执行此操作,但似乎SSIS应该有更直接的方法.

编辑

这行代码实际上最终会抛出异常:

sqlConn = (System.Data.SqlClient.SqlConnection)cm.AcquireConnection(Dts.Transaction);
Run Code Online (Sandbox Code Playgroud)

它写道:"无法将'System._ComObject'类型的COM对象强制转换为类类型'System.Data.SqlClient.SqlConection.'"

c# sql sql-server ssis script-task

16
推荐指数
1
解决办法
6万
查看次数

不存在作为 Secret 颁发的证书

以下是describeclusterissuercertificate资源的输出。我是 cert-manager 的新手,所以不能 100% 确定它设置正确 - 我们需要使用http01验证但是我们没有使用 nginx 控制器。现在我们只有 2 个微服务,所以面向公众的 IP 地址只属于一个 k8s 服务(负载均衡器类型),该服务将流量路由到一个 pod,其中一个可扩展服务代理容器位于运行应用程序代码的容器前面。使用此设置我无法获得除以下错误之外的任何信息,但是正如我所提到的,我是 cert-manager 和 ESP 的新手,因此这可能配置不正确...

Name:         clusterissuer-dev
Namespace:    
Labels:       <none>
Annotations:  kubectl.kubernetes.io/last-applied-configuration:
API Version:  cert-manager.io/v1beta1
Kind:         ClusterIssuer
Metadata:
  Creation Timestamp:  2020-08-07T18:46:29Z
  Generation:          1
  Resource Version:    4550439
  Self Link:           /apis/cert-manager.io/v1beta1/clusterissuers/clusterissuer-dev
  UID:                 65933d87-1893-49af-b90e-172919a18534
Spec:
  Acme:
    Email:  email@test.com
    Private Key Secret Ref:
      Name:  letsencrypt-dev
    Server:  https://acme-staging-v02.api.letsencrypt.org/directory
    Solvers:
      http01:
        Ingress:
          Class:  nginx
Status:
  Acme:
    Last Registered Email:  email@test.com
    Uri: …
Run Code Online (Sandbox Code Playgroud)

google-kubernetes-engine cert-manager

16
推荐指数
2
解决办法
1万
查看次数

将NULL值分配给SqlParameter的最佳方法

我在C#类方法中使用了许多可选的输入参数.由于可选语法在未使用参数时会创建值"0",因此我在方法中调用的SQL插入命令将逐渐插入.但是,我需要命令在不使用参数时插入NULL值而不是0.在不使用大量"if"语句的情况下实现此目的的最佳方法是什么?

以下是我所指的代码.是否有某种语法/命令允许我在SqlParameter声明中指定NULL值?

public int batchInsert
(
    int id, 
    int outcome, 
    int input = 0, 
    int add = 0, 
    int update = 0,
    int delete = 0,
    int errors = 0, 
    int warnings = 0
)
{
    string sts;
    if (outcome == 0)
    {
        sts = "S";
    }
    else if (outcome == 1)
    {
        sts = "W";
    }
    else
    {
        sts = "E";
    }

    SqlConnection sqlConn = new SqlConnection(this.connString);
    SqlParameter runId = new SqlParameter("@runId", id);
    SqlParameter endTime = new SqlParameter("@endTime", DateTime.Now); …
Run Code Online (Sandbox Code Playgroud)

c# null sqlparameter

15
推荐指数
1
解决办法
4万
查看次数

用户GETDATE()将当前日期放入SQL变量

我正在尝试使用以下命令将当前日期转换为SQL存储过程中的变量

DECLARE @LastChangeDate as date
SET @LastChangeDate = SELECT GETDATE()
Run Code Online (Sandbox Code Playgroud)

这给了我以下错误:"SELECT'附近的语法不正确"

这是我写过的第一个存储过程,所以我不熟悉变量在SQL中的工作方式.

sql t-sql

13
推荐指数
2
解决办法
9万
查看次数

从AssemblyInfo.cs获取并替换AssemblyVersion

我有我使用(仅测试)来更新一个正则表达式AssemblyVersionAssemblyInfo.cs文件.但是,我想知道从.cs文件中提取和替换此值的最佳方法是什么?

这是我最好的猜测,显然,它不起作用,但总体思路已经到位.希望有点优雅的东西.

Get-Content $file | Foreach-Object{
    $var = $_
    if($var -contains "AssemblyVersion"){
        $temp = [regex]::match($s, '"([^"]+)"').Groups[1].Value.Substring(0, $prog.LastIndexOf(".")+1) + 1234
        $var = $var.SubString(0, $var.FirstIndexOf('"') + $temp + $var.SubString($var.LastIndexOf('"'), $var.Length-1))
    }
}
Run Code Online (Sandbox Code Playgroud)

编辑

这里的每个请求是我要在AssemblyInfo中更新的行:

[assembly: AssemblyVersion("1.0.0.0")] 
Run Code Online (Sandbox Code Playgroud)

powershell

12
推荐指数
1
解决办法
1万
查看次数